Description

Configured for multi-channel machinery data acquisition in 3500 Machinery Protection System platforms, the Bently Nevada 3500/64 176449-05 (3500/64M Dynamic Pressure Monitor) provides direct physical/electrical execution. The instrument integrates continuous dynamic tracking variables to monitor combustor pressure instabilities across internal processing loops without external computer interaction.

Hardware Specifications

ParameterSpecification
Model3500/64 (Main Board: 176449-05)
BrandBently Nevada
OriginUnited States
Weight0.82 kg
Dimensions241.3 x 24.4 x 241.8 mm
Operating Temp-30 to +65 deg C
Channel Count4 independent channels
Input SignalHigh-temperature pressure transducers (100 mV/psi or 1.45 mV/mBar)
Frequency RangeLow Mode: 5 Hz to 4 kHz; High Mode: 10 Hz to 14.75 kHz
Buffered Outputs1 coaxial connector per channel on front panel (550 Ohm output impedance)
Recorder Outputs+4 to +20 mA per channel (0 to +12 VDC compliance range)

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What is the function of Cascade Mode on the 3500/64 monitor?

A: Cascade Mode allows a single physical pressure transducer input to drive all four internal monitoring channels simultaneously, enabling up to four separate bandpass filter options and four distinct full-scale configurations from one hardware source.

Q: How do the Low Mode and High Mode selections alter the hardware filter characteristics?

A: Low Mode configures a 10-pole filter providing 200 dB per decade attenuation between 5 Hz and 4 kHz. High Mode implements a 6-pole filter providing 120 dB per decade attenuation between 10 Hz and 14.75 kHz.

Field Installation Guidelines

  1. Insert the 176449-05 main card into a single slot from the front of the 3500 system chassis, ensuring full seating alignment with the rear I/O card.

  2. Maintain separate cable trays for transducer input links to isolate weak millivolt analog loops from high-current industrial power distribution fields.

  3. Configure the line rejection notch filter to match local electrical grids (50 Hz or 60 Hz) through the 3500 Rack Configuration Software to isolate line frequency anomalies.

  4. Utilize short-circuit protected front-panel coaxial connectors for diagnostic test instruments without impacting the active machinery protection relay parameters.

  5. Tighten the card retention screws completely into the chassis frame to ensure consistent backplane electrical bonding and reference ground paths.
